Output 51c8dc0129c0b6ace165932b33a08444ee342fdbcb0aa9918b444224ca1cf807:5

value
492486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1772fb64821f7962967149e96c5c114ccc7f08f3 OP_EQUAL
address
33q1D3b72DAkewqGyTeLZMhDZMw4pBgjq2
transaction
51c8dc0129c0b6ace165932b33a08444ee342fdbcb0aa9918b444224ca1cf807
spent
true